Cuvée Charlotte
Château Hostens~Picant
Cuvée Charlotte 2020
A classic white Bordeaux Blanc from Sainte Foy Cotes de Bordeaux from the winery Château Hostens~Picant. Made from Sauvignon Blanc, Sémillon and Muscadelle grapes with 3 months of oak aging. The wine is named after one of the sisters who makes the wine: Charlotte Picant.
Glass Burgundy style
Grapes sauvignon blanc (65%), sémillon (30%) & muscadelle (5%)
Flavors basil, verbena, citrus such as lemon and grapefruit, jasmine & flowers
Serve 11 to 14 degrees Celsius
Appellation Sainte Foy Côtes de Bordeaux, Bordeaux, France
Food seafood, blanquette de veau, dishes with poached chicken, fish in rich sauces, grilled North Sea fish, soft cheeses, asparagus and salads
Alcohol 14.5%
Winemaker Valentine & Charlotte Picant with the help of Derenoncourt Consultants
Background Yves (Valentine and Charlotte's father) bought the house and land in 1986 as a country house. He saw potential in the region and the soil and wanted to show the new face of Bordeaux. Modern, dynamic and accessible became the main goals. Gastronomic wines with an eye for sustainability brought them to their success.
Soil Clay in combination with slate
Altitude 50 to 150 meters above sea level
Soil management Organic (in conversion)
Harvest The grapes are harvested by hand from vines aged 20 to 25 years
Vinification Both fermentation and aging take place in 400-liter barriques for 9 months with bâtonnage
Filtering Plate filter
